Introduction | www.seagate.com |
The Serial ATA interface connects each disk drive in a
The host adapter may, optionally, emulate a master/slave environment to host software where two
devices on separate Serial ATA ports are represented to host software as a Device 0 (master) and Device
Note 1 (slave) accessed at the same set of host bus addresses. A host adapter that emulates a master/slave environment manages two sets of shadow registers. This is not a typical Serial ATA environment.
The Serial ATA host adapter and drive share the function of emulating parallel ATA device behavior to provide backward compatibility with existing host systems and software. The Command and Control Block registers, PIO and DMA data transfers, resets, and interrupts are all emulated.The Serial ATA host adapter contains a set of registers that shadow the contents of the traditional device registers, referred to as the Shadow Register Block. All Serial ATA devices behave like Device 0 devices. For additional information about how Serial ATA emulates parallel ATA, refer to the “Serial ATA International Organization: Serial ATA Revision 3.0”. The specification can be downloaded from
10 | Barracuda Green SATA Product Manual, Rev. D |